### replicas
Replicas modify the number of replicas for a resource without creating patches.
E.g. Given this kubernetes Deployment fragment:
```
metadata:
name: deployment-name
spec:
replicas: 3
```
one can change the number of replicas to 5 with the following *kustomization*:
```
replicas:
- name: deployment-name
count: 5
```
note that replicas is a list, so many replicas can be modified at the same time.
